Robin initial-boundary value problem for nonlinear Schrodinger equation with potential

摘要
We study the initial-boundary value problem for the Schrodinger equation with potential, posed on positive half-line t u + ia1. xx u + ia2| u| 2u + a3P 1 2 u = 0, where a1. R, a2. C, a3 > 0, P 1 2 is the fractional derivative operator defined by the modified Risz potential P 1 2 u = 1 2p 8 0 dy sign ( x - y) | x - y| 1 2. yu ( y, t). We are interested in the initial-boundary value problem with small initial data and Robin boundary data given in a suitable weighted Sobolev spaces. We show that problem admits global solutions whose long-time behavior essentially depends on the boundary data.
